Specialties
Bringing the freshest seafood to Arlington, VA, McCormick & Schmick’s Seafood Restaurant is located close to the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, the Pentagon, and the Arlington National Cemetery.
We serve more than 30 varieties of fresh seafood flown in daily from both U.S. and international waters, available from menus that change DAILY. This is THE place to socialize in the best of traditions. Prepared using fresh ingredients, your food is served in a timeless and traditional presentation.
Enjoy the spirited and lively atmosphere of our bar after a show and watch our bartenders practice traditional mixology, making hand-crafted cocktails using fresh-squeezed juices, never using blenders or mixes.

History
Established in 2004.
The history of McCormick & Schmick’s Seafood Restaurants began when Bill McCormick purchased Jake’s Famous Crawfish Restaurant located in Portland, Oregon, and brought the more than 100-year-old landmark back to life. When asked the secret of how he revitalized a restaurant on the brink of closing, McCormick says, «I like nothing better than being a good host.»
Part of the managerial talent McCormick tapped was Doug Schmick, a management trainee. The two formed a partnership in 1974, creating Traditional Concepts, a precursor to today’s McCormick & Schmick’s Seafood Restaurants. In 1979, they opened the original McCormick & Schmick’s Seafood Restaurant in Portland, Oregon. Since that time, the company has expanded to more than 80 restaurants across the country.
